Lance Armstrong & The Triumph of the Will

Lance Armstrong rode into history Sunday, winning a record sixth straight Tour de France and cementing his place as one of the greatest athletes of all time. Never in its 101-year history has the Tour had a winner like Armstrong, who just eight years ago was given less than a 50 percent chance of overcoming testicular cancer that spread to his lungs and brain.
Yet, this triumph of will, and despite a very public divorce, his brand leverage has never been greater, last year netting him more than $19 million in endorsements… surely, he’ll stand to earn far more than that moving forward.
